by Lashawn Faison-Bradley Lpc (Author)

The book explore the impact of Complex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der with African American females and the role that spirituality plays in their recovery. Complex PTSD is defined as a condition that results from chronic or long-term exposure to trauma over which a victim has little or no control of such as in cases of domestic, emotional, physical or sexual abuse. With regards to African-American women Complex PTSD include intergenerational trauma, sexism, classism, racism, historical trauma, child abuse, community violence, and oppression.
